heater? warm to the touch

ok, so i am getting close to stocking my aquarium, co2 equipment should arrive early this week. So in preparation i put my heater in the tank. It has been about 24 hours and I am around 80 degrees. Touched the heater and it did not feel warm at all, Should it me warm when i touch it. Unfortunatly i do not know the wattage, it was a handme down from a friend.

It should feel warm to the touch when it operates. But if it's off or just coming on chances are it's going to be the same as the water temp.

yeah, it's only warm to the touch when it's been on a little while.
I'd turn it down to 78 tho.
